A unique home in Jaipur has caught the attention of social media users for its striking 2D palace inspired interiors. The house, which looks like a hand drawn royal sketch brought to life, was featured in a video shared on Instagram by content creator Priyam Saraswat.A Jaipur house went viral for its unique 2D palace design, with sketch like interiors inspired by the city’s royal heritage. Please.”A palace inside a homeAs they enter the house, the interiors immediately stand out because of their sketch like visual effect. The homeowner explains, “This is basically like to live in a sketch of a palace. So, we created depth in this.”(Also read: Inside an Indore house where everything gleams in 24-carat gold: 'Even the sockets are gold')Saraswat observes how the furniture blends with the overall design and says, “All the furniture also is merging right with the effect.” The homeowner adds, “And even with the flooring.” Saraswat then says, “It’s all like an illusion which you have created, right?” to which the homeowner replies, “Yes.”During the tour, the homeowner points out several Jaipur inspired elements. “This is the famous Peacock Gate of City Palace. This is like the entry of the Darbar Hall. This is the famous Jal Mahal of Jaipur. Let’s see the bedroom,” he says.Inside the bedroom, he describes the setup as “the king’s bed” and points to the Hawa Mahal inspired design above it. When Saraswat asks about another area, the homeowner says, “This is the wardrobe.” A surprised Saraswat responds, “This is the wardrobe?” The homeowner says, “Yeah,” adding that it has “lot of Sherwanis, lot of embroidery.”Inspired by Jaipur’s heritageThe tour also features another room inspired by Amer Palace. The homeowner says, “So, this is the Amer, famous Amer Palace of Jaipur,” adding that elephants carry tourists there. He also introduces miniature artist Ratan Ji, saying, “From generations, they’ve been doing the Pichwayi art, the miniature art.”In the final conversation, Saraswat says, “You have a very, very unique house. I really loved it.” The homeowner replies, “Thank you so much. See, I saw this 2D concept, and I thought of creating a sketch of a palace. We are nowhere to copy from. You come out of the 2D, and you become the 3D element.”(Also read: Indian-origin techie gives tour of his luxurious palatial home in Silicon Valley, internet calls it ‘dream house’)He further adds, “People are going and running after like Wabi-Sabi and Scandinavian, and if we look at our own culture, there is so much of depth in it and so much of creativity.”Watch the clip here:Internet reactsThe clip has amassed several reactions from viewers.
